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

 

The essential functions of the Service Technician - Electrician are to provide general electrical repairs and services.  This position handles service calls to customers in their homes and utilizes customer service training to educate and assist customers in choosing service, products and finance options.

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.  This individual must be willing to pursue, develop and participate in continuing education.    The Service Technician must meet or exceed shop minimums set for the Dot Program or its equivalent.

 

Must know local electrical codes and be able to apply them in a practical manner on each job.  Must be able to work with inspectors, suppliers and co-worker technicians to ensure correct project work, while abiding by all codes.  Must be able to draw simple wiring diagrams and be able to read other diagrams.   Must be capable of following a wiring diagram on tracing installed wire.  Must be able to install electrical hardware such as junction boxes, and circuit breaker units.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S 

The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

 

Regularly requires sitting, walking, bending, and lifting for prolonged periods of time.

 

The employee must have a full range of body movements including the use of hands feet and fingers to handle or feel objects and must be capable of bending, reaching, and crouching.  Able to handle or feel objects and use tools and equipment and must be capable of bending, reaching, crouching, climbing and crawling.

 

Must have command of all five senses sight, hearing, touch, smell and taste.  Specific vision abilities required include close v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ust and focus.  Must hear and speak well enough to conduct business over the telephone or face to face for long periods of time.

 

Must be able to lift 100 pounds.

 

WORK ENVIRONMENT 

The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

 

This position will require working indoors and outdoors in various climate conditions ranging from very cold with rain to very hot and humid. This includes attics, crawl spaces, and confined locations.  The employee may be called upon to be in customer or service production sites on an as need to basis.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.

 

Priority 1 Electric is a 24-hour service company so you will be required to be on call after hours and for emergencies.  Typical business hours are from 7:00 am - 3:30 pm, Monday through Friday.
